Brighton defender Ben White has said winning his first England cap was a dream come true.
The 23-year-old defender replaced Jack Grealish in the 71st minute to become England’s 1,261 selected and only Albion’s fifth player to play for the Three Lions.
White helped England maintain their 1-0 lead over Austria in the 91st minute as he cleared Alessandro Schopf’s low shot at the line, after Jordan Pickford made a mess by kicking a ball .
